Descriptionsyslinux (SYSLINUX/PXELINUX/ISOLINUX boot loaders) SYSLINUX is a boot loader for the Linux operating system which operates off an MS-DOS/Windows FAT filesystem. This is used by the Slackware makebootdisk script to create system boot floppies. Also included are PXELINUX and ISOLINUX, boot loaders for booting from a network server or CD-ROM. SYSLINUX, PXELINUX, and ISOLINUX were written by H. Peter Anvin.
